## Ownership: Flaky Integration Tests — Pebblepay Service

The Pebblepay integration suite has known flaky tests around the settlement retry path, tracked on the flake board. On-call: if the nightly suite fails, rerun once before paging anyone; two consecutive failures on the same test are treated as real. Do not quarantine tests yourself — quarantine decisions are centralized to keep coverage honest. For quarantine requests, flake triage, or questions about the settlement fixtures, contact the owner listed below.

account owner for kafop-haweg: Pelax Gilael Istir

Release step 7 (Snapfeather thumbnail queue): confirm the queue drains fully before cutting the tag. Check the worker dashboard, verify zero pending jobs for at least five minutes, and record queue depth in the release log. Paste the build token that appears below into the sign-off sheet.

pipeline stamp: htk31_f769b577b3028a4e9958e5bb8d1259a

**Handover — dispatch heuristic**

Hey, passing the Wrenfold driver-assignment heuristic to you while I'm out. Quick context for your review: it scores drivers by proximity and shift load, then greedily assigns within each zone of the Copperhay region. The scoring weights live in config, not code, which is why past tweaks never showed up in diffs — worth flagging in your writeup. Watch the fairness cap; ops keeps nudging it. Current production settings for the scorer are listed here.

service settings:
PRAIX_LOG_LEVEL=error
PRAIX_METRICS_HOST=metrics.praix.qorvelcorp.corp
PRAIX_POOL_SIZE=16